Subject: DocSentry cut-over complete

Team — the switch from the legacy prose checker to DocSentry finished last night. All support-facing docs now lint on commit. Old warnings were bulk-triaged; anything marked "legacy-waived" can be ignored. New failures block merges, so expect a few tickets from writers this week. Style rules are stricter on headings and admonitions. The old checker is fully retired; do not re-enable it. DocSentry runs in every repo with the following configuration.

settings of kagag-kagef:
[kelath]
port = 9300
region = west-4
host = kelath.olvarqworks.example
team = sorion
timeout_ms = 1000
retries = 8

Alert: WS_RECONNECT_STORM fired for the Cordwave realtime service. This indicates clients are stuck in a reconnect loop, typically triggered when a session token expires mid-handshake and the client retries without refreshing it. Expect elevated connection counts and user reports of frozen live feeds. Support should confirm the affected region, note the start time, and avoid restarting the edge nodes before the on-call engineer responds. Detailed triage steps are documented here:

runbook for badug-kadup: https://confluence.zemvarlabs.internal/projects/browse/display/projects/bd1b

# Meridian Plus Tier — Manager Overview

This page summarizes the new Meridian Plus subscription tier launching next quarter at Cobaltine Systems. The tier adds priority rendering, expanded storage, and the Quillview analytics add-on at a mid-range price point. Pilot feedback from the Varnholm test group was positive. As incoming director, you should familiarize yourself with the rollout schedule before the pricing committee meets. The following note provides essential context.

board note of tadup-tajog: Headcount on the Oliiel team goes from 31 to 88 by the end of February. Gross margin on Oliiel came in at 62 percent against a plan of 29 percent.